Reseña del libro "Historical Sketches of the Rise of the Scots old Independent and the Inghamite Churches: With the Correspondence Which led to Their Union (en Inglés)"

Historical Sketches is a detailed and comprehensive history of two important 19th century religious movements, the Scots Old Independent and the Inghamite churches. Written by James McGavin, John Green, and William Edmondson, this book offers deep insight into the origins, beliefs, and development of these influential denominations, and provides context for their eventual union.
